PHARMACISTS AND CONFECTIONERS IN ALENÇON (La Communauté des Apoticaires, Droguistes & Confiseurs de la ville d'Alençon)

Coat of arms (crest) of Pharmacists and Confectioners in Alençon
Official blazon
French D 'argent, a deux viperes de sinople posées en fasses.
English blazon wanted

Origin/meaning

Snakes are a generic symbol for medical professions.
